Encryption Protocols: Betrolla’s SSL vs Industry Leaders

Encryption standards are critical for safeguarding user data during online transactions. Betrolla claims to use S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) encryption, a foundational security protocol. However, industry leaders like Betfair and 1xBet implement advanced encryption technologies such as TLS 1.3, which offers 30% stronger security against cyberattacks. For example, TLS 1.3 reduces handshake latency and provides enhanced protection for sensitive information like banking details and personal data.

In a comparative analysis, Betrolla’s SSL encryption aligns with industry standards but falls short of the more robust TLS protocols used by top operators. This difference translates into a lower risk of man-in-the-middle attacks and data interception. For users prioritizing maximum security, choosing platforms that deploy TLS 1.3 or higher is advisable. As a practical step, always verify the security certificate in your browser—look for “https” and a padlock icon—before entering payment information.

Die historische Entwicklung der Schutzmasken ist eng verbunden mit den gesellschaftlichen Bedürfnissen und kulturellen Überzeugungen ihrer Zeit. In Europa begannen Masken bereits im Mittelalter als Teil von rituellen Zeremonien und Volksfesten eine bedeutende Rolle zu spielen. Im 17. und 18. Jahrhundert wurden Masken in der europäischen Gesellschaft auch als Statussymbole genutzt, etwa bei Maskenbällen, bei denen sie die soziale Hierarchie verschleierten und gleichzeitig zur Darstellung persönlicher Identität beitrugen. Gleichzeitig wurden Schutzmasken in der Medizin, beispielsweise während Epidemien wie der Pest, zu lebenswichtigen Objekten. Diese Entwicklung zeigt die Vielschichtigkeit ihrer Funktionen: Schutz, Identitätsbildung und soziale Interaktion.

The Science of Natural Patterns: Insights Beyond Mathematics

Natural patterns emerge from complex biological processes that often defy simple mathematical descriptions. These patterns, such as the intricate markings on animal coats or the fractal branching of trees, result from emergent behaviors driven by genetic, environmental, and physical factors. For example, the pigmentation patterns on zebra stripes or butterfly wings are not randomly distributed but follow genetic algorithms that optimize camouflage and signaling.

Research in developmental biology reveals mechanisms like reaction-diffusion systems—first described by Alan Turing—that explain how simple chemical interactions can produce complex, repeating patterns. These biological insights have been pivotal in inspiring digital algorithms capable of generating lifelike, organic textures in computer graphics and virtual environments.

A notable case study is fractal geometry in flora and fauna. The branching patterns of bronchial tubes, blood vessels, and root systems exhibit self-similarity across scales, reflecting efficiency in resource distribution. Such fractal principles inform the development of algorithms that create naturalistic landscapes and textures in video games and simulations, enhancing realism and immersion.

Morphology of Natural Waves: From Ocean Currents to Data Flows

Characteristics of Wave Behavior in Natural Environments

Natural waves—such as ocean swells, wind ripples, and seismic waves—exhibit properties like amplitude, frequency, and phase that influence their interaction with environments. These waves are characterized by their ability to transfer energy across distances while maintaining coherence, a feature that has inspired digital designers seeking fluidity and responsiveness in interfaces.

Analogies Between Physical Wave Dynamics and Information Transmission

Just as ocean waves propagate energy through water, data signals traverse digital networks via modulated waveforms. The principles of wave interference, reflection, and diffraction find their counterparts in signal processing—such as beamforming in wireless communications or the ripple effects of user interactions on a web page. Recognizing these parallels allows developers to craft interfaces that feel more natural and intuitive.

Implications for Designing Fluid, Adaptive Digital Interfaces

By mimicking the behavior of natural waves, digital interfaces can adapt seamlessly to user inputs, creating experiences that seem to flow organically. For instance, employing wave-inspired animations in menus or transitions can enhance user engagement and reduce cognitive load. Research shows that interfaces resembling natural patterns increase user satisfaction and ease of navigation, especially in immersive environments like virtual reality or augmented reality.

Harnessing Self-Organization for Digital Innovation

Principles of Self-Organization in Natural Systems

Self-organization refers to the spontaneous emergence of order in systems without external control, driven by local interactions. Examples include the formation of termite mounds, flocking behavior in birds, and the patterning of snowflakes. These phenomena demonstrate how simple rules at the micro-level can produce complex, adaptive macrostructures.

Applications in Decentralized Digital Networks and AI

Inspired by natural self-organization, decentralized algorithms like swarm intelligence optimize network routing, resource allocation, and AI learning processes. Multi-agent systems, modeled after ant colonies or bird flocks, enable robust, scalable, and fault-tolerant digital environments. These systems adapt dynamically, much like their natural counterparts, providing resilience against disruptions and evolving in response to user interactions.

Historical Perspectives: Symbols as Eternal Markers of Glory

Ancient civilizations employed a variety of symbols to immortalize their heroes and victories. In Rome, laurel wreaths awarded to victorious generals symbolized honor and eternal fame. These wreaths, often depicted in frescoes and coins, linked personal achievement with divine favor. Trophies and standards, such as the Roman Aquila (eagle), served as sacred military symbols representing the might and continuity of the empire.

Victorious rewards were frequently dedicated to gods, a practice believed to transfer the hero’s glory into the divine realm, thus achieving a form of immortality. These tangible tokens of victory functioned as enduring symbols of human achievement beyond the individual’s lifespan.

The Concept of Fame and Legacy in Ancient Cultures

For gladiators, fame was often the ultimate goal—public recognition that could transcend death. Gladiators like Spartacus became legends through inscriptions, public monuments, and popular stories. These symbols of heroism—statues, inscriptions, and even coinage—became tools for preserving their memory.

Different cultures had unique approaches. The Chinese emphasized ancestral rites and temple statues to honor heroes, while the Egyptians built monumental pyramids and tombs. These enduring structures and symbols served as anchors for collective remembrance, demonstrating that societies have long sought ways to enshrine their greatest figures.
